Synthesis of bulk materials
A comprehensive library of 2D materials for ink fabrication has been successfully established by the Graphene Flagship's 2D-PRINTABLE project, covering a broad range of material classes, including p-type and n-type semiconductors, metals, insulators, and functional materials such as ferroelectrics, multiferroics, superconductors, and magnetic 2D compounds.

Graphene Week 2025 Celebrates 20 Years of Pioneering Innovation in 2D Materials
The Graphene Flagship organised the 20th edition of Graphene Week, taking place 22–26 September 2025 in Vicenza, Italy. As Europe’s longest-running and leading forum on graphene and 2D materials, the event served both as a celebration of progress achieved and a catalyst for future discoveries.

Stretching the Limits of Graphene with Robin Smeyers
For Robin Smeyers, a passion for 2D materials began with a single thesis and quickly grew into a full-blown research journey. What started as a master’s project on graphene became a launchpad for academic discovery, leading him to a PhD focused on one of the most intriguing frontiers in condensed matter physics: straintronics. Robin’s work ranges from simulating balloon-like graphene structures to exploring the possibilities of room-temperature superconductors, laying the foundation for technologies that could one day transform our world.
